On March 14, 2024, Belgium clinched victory in the World Student Diplomacy Championship, a prestigious competition simulating the workings of the United Nations.

Held over the course of five days in Taipei, Taiwan, this annual event is organised by Harvard WorldMUN (Model United Nations) and draws participation from around a hundred countries.

During the championship, 1,000 to 1,500 young delegates assume the roles of diplomats, passionately advocating for the interests of the countries they represent. Each participant represents a delegation from a country other than their own, engaging in diplomatic negotiations and debates on global issues.

Belgium's inter-university team, comprised of 23 students from esteemed Belgian institutions such as UNamur, UCLouvain, ULB, KU Leuven, VUB, and UAntwerpen, showcased exceptional skill and teamwork throughout the competition. Nick Swinnen, chairman of the Belgian delegation, revealed that Belgium primarily represented Pakistan, Canada, and Denmark during the championship.

The conference focused on pressing global issues including cybersecurity, energy transition, nuclear energy, and migration to Syria, mirroring the agenda of the United Nations. Once again, Belgium demonstrated its diplomatic prowess by emerging victorious. This marks Belgium's eleventh championship win and its fourth consecutive triumph in the competition.
